Oracle GoldenGate 12c Implementer's Guide, by John P Jeffries

Leverage the power of real-time data access for designing, building, and tuning your GoldenGate EnterpriseAbout This Book

  • Orchestrate the rich features of GoldenGate 12c and exploit the performance-enhancing features and manageability in your Enterprise environment
  • Master data integration techniques to empower your organisation's readiness to migrate to cloud technologies quickly and easily
  • An easy-to-follow step-by-step guide full of hands-on examples that offer a solid foundation of real-time data integration and replication in heterogeneous IT environments
Who This Book Is For

The book is aimed at Oracle database administrators, project managers, and solution architects who wish to extend their knowledge of GoldenGate. The reader is assumed to be familiar with Oracle databases. No knowledge of GoldenGate is required.

What You Will Learn
  • Extend GoldenGate's out-of-the-box functionality to employ its rich features and meet your business objectives
  • Deliver best-in-class data integration solutions by integrating GoldenGate with other Oracle products
  • Deploy data integration solutions effectively to lower your total cost of ownership and increase you ROI
  • Extend GoldenGate functionality through APIs and reduce your IT operational expenditure
  • Leverage the designs to build efficient, cost effective data integration solutions
  • Enhance system management and monitoring in your GoldenGate environment
  • Generate real-time statistics to gauge data throughput and performance
  • Evaluate data integration concepts through Oracle's new Integration Cloud Service offering
In Detail

GoldenGate exchanges data among systems in a timely manner and meets the demand for real-time access to information regardless of volume. The new release, 12c, includes an optimized database, intelligent and integrated delivery capabilities, expanded heterogeneity, and tighter security. Perform zero downtime data migration to on-premise or public cloud with GoldenGate's feature-rich portfolio.

Start with the installation and learn the design concepts and enhanced configuration of GoldenGate 12c. Exploit new 12c features to successfully implement GoldenGate on your enterprise. Dive deep into configuring GoldenGate for high availability, DDL support, and reverse processing. Build fast, secure, robust, scalable technical solutions by tuning data delivery and networks. Finally, enrich your data replication knowledge by learning the troubleshooting tips.

About the Author

John P Jeffries

John P Jeffries has worked in many countries around the world, consulting on the Oracle technology. He is interested in different cultures and enjoys teaching others. At present, John lives and works in Singapore and is employed as a subject matter expert at a global bank, delivering enterprise-wide infrastructure design solutions, particularly in the database private cloud and data replication space. Since he wrote his first book, Oracle GoldenGate 11g Implementer's Guide, he has been heavily focused on leveraging Oracle's Fusion Middleware products (including GoldenGate) to address performance, data migration, and data delivery issues. With over 15 years of experience in Oracle, John has worked for a number of global organizations, such as BT, Siebel Systems, Dell, Thomson Reuters, and Oracle Corporation, to name a few. At Oracle, he worked in advanced customer services on key accounts as a senior principal consultant and became the UK data replication expert, often publishing articles on his own website (http://oracle11ggotchas.com/). John is an Oracle Certified Professional and a GoldenGate specialist. He gives presentations at ODTUG conferences and continues to share his real-life hands-on experience through his work. Known for his ability to provide robust, effective solutions and workarounds, John delivers his knowledge, tips, and tricks in his new book, Oracle GoldenGate 12c Implementer's Guide.

By Ralf Korff
The core of this implementer’s guide consists of chapters 2 and 4-7 which deal on approx. 200 pages with configuration issues. Chapters 8-10 with together approx. 100 pages help to master administrative challenges. I like the level of detail presented. These chapters are detailed and specific down to the command line; in a step-by-step manner. When appropriate they refer to other sources, for instance to MOS documents,. If you have recently attended an Oracle University’s workshop you get an idea what to expect. Of course, without the virtual machines for your exercises. (Offering such machines-right out of the cloud-which are suitable to work through a book like this could be a new business opportunity for publishers.)
I consider database administrators the main target audience because most people, who implement GoldenGate 12c, will also administering it later on and will very likely also be the DBAs of the involved databases. Having experience with GoldenGate is undoubtedly an advantage for DBAs and that’s where this book is about.
Besides being a DBA I’ve bought this book also because I like to get information about issues Oracle’s own documenters might rather skip to mention. Well, I cannot tell that the author has taken a grain of salt on Oracle’s product. OK, such is not necessarily to expect in the step-by-step-exercises mentioned above. However, the surrounding chapters, Chapter 1: Getting started and Chapter 11: The Future of GoldenGate, could have been a place to show some critical distance. While these chapters shall set the stage I felt they are rather short on information and read like written by a salesperson. Here the Oracle documentation does a better job and is indeed more neutral. By skimming over this first and last chapter only I wouldn’t have bought this book, certainly not! Yet I’m glad to possess it and am looking forward to get hands on experience.
For its core chapters I’d give this book unhesitatingly five stars but have to subtract one star for the “salesperson chapters” which to read was a waste of time. Also Chapter 3: Design Considerations is a d�j� vu with chapter 1, it contains redundant information and illustrations or adds new topics merely by mentioning them. If you don’t already know the themes it is touching then you have definitely to resort to other sources. Somehow I got the impression that the chapters 1, 3, and 11 must have been written by another author.
Let me give an example for the downgrade: The active-passive topology is short mentioned in chapter 1 on page 16. There you’ll find the promise that differences between GoldenGate and Data Guard are explained in greater detail in chapter 3. Whereas in chapter 3 you’ll find an equally short and greatly redundant section on active-passive replication (only 21 text lines starting on page 79f). There you’ll get the information that Data Guard features a physical standby database (synchronizing at block level) and that GoldenGate may not necessarily be the best Disaster Recovery solution. Further a note that Data Guard usage is included in GoldenGate’s license. That’s all. No mentioning of logical standby, different database versions, no decision criterions what product to use when.
Readers who are solely interested in solution scenarios (like architects) will not benefit from this book. Administrators (and implementers alike) who must be able to do also the architect’s part have to complement this book with Oracle’s free documentation and whitepapers. Whatever, 8 chapters are superb, dealing step by step with the implementation and administration of Oracle’s GoldenGate and which do help to put this product into practice, efficiently, reliably and with confidence. I can warmly recommend it.

By Busy Gal
John Jeffries book “Oracle GoldenGate 12c Implementer’s Guide” has been of incredible help to our team. The book is so good that I personally purchased and gave the 2 other DBAs on my team a copy.

Oracle’s documentation for GoldenGate 12c is very limited, and doesn’t give enough details. If this is your first attempt at GoldenGate it will be a difficult to get enough information to get GoldenGate up and running.

Jeffries book not only did a great job at explaining what the various choices for replication are, he gives you great examples and the level of detail was a ***fantastic*** help to assisting us in getting a fully functioning prototype running quickly.

This book is worth every single penny!

Perfect startup learning goldengate
By Jos van den oord
This book is written in very simple, straight forward and easy to understand language. Good amount of details in topics of Goldengate processes (Manager, Extract, Pump, and Replicat) parameter settings. Simple explanations of new Goldengate 12c features; coordinated and intergrated processes, password security with Credential store, Goldengate agent implementation on oracle grid infrastructure, and Oracle streams migration setup to Goldengate processes. For developers topics as using and defining macros for better and easy deployments of automate repetitive tasks wit exception handlers. Default aspects as integration wit Oracle Data Integrator the E-TL architecture. Very useful Goldengate 12c implementation handbook for developers and DBA’s, experience as newbie.
